unshift @args, $c;
if( $name ) {
+ # Direct component hash lookup to avoid costly regexps
return $container->get_component($name, \@args)
if $container->has_service($name) && !ref $name;
if( $name ) {
# Direct component hash lookup to avoid costly regexps
return $container->get_component($name, \@args)
- if ( !ref $name && $container->has_service($name));
+ if $container->has_service($name) && !ref $name;
return $container->get_component_regexp( $c, $name, \@args );
}